Dress in your most outrageous clothes and help fight bowel cancerWe live in a fashion-conscious world. Every hemline is scrutinised. Every jacket is analysed. Wouldn’t it be lovely to have a break from all that for once? For one week only, the charity Beating Bowel Cancer is encouraging you to don the loudest and most outrageous clothes you can find. And by throwing sartorial caution to the wind, you will be helping to support bowel cancer patients and their families across the UK.   (more…)

Bowel Cancer UK is the UK's leading bowel cancer charityFollowing last week’s post on Bowel Cancer Awareness Month, the campaign’s creators, Bowel Cancer UK, write a guest post about the signs and symptoms of the condition and tell us why the campaign is so important.

Bowel Cancer UK is encouraging men and women to be aware of the signs and symptoms of the disease this Bowel Cancer Awareness Month – April 2012.

Bowel cancer (also known as colorectal or colon cancer) is the second most common cause of cancer death in the UK, affecting both men and women. Every year over 40,000 people are diagnosed with bowel cancer and more than 16,000 people die of the disease. But this doesn’t have to be the case. Bowel cancer is very treatable, especially if it’s caught early. That’s why awareness of the symptoms is so important. (more…)
